Established in 1994, Baker Smith Management was a privately-owned events and sports management and marketing company. In conjunction, Michael Baker Management was established to provide specialised management services to high profile athletes and media personalities within Australia.As a founder & General Manager of Baker Smith Management Pty Ltd and Michael Baker Management , I was responsible for the day to day operational and financial activities for both companies. In addition, my role expanded to offering personalised, exclusive management to high profile clients by providing representation and a variety of services such as sourcing, negotiating and securing contract agreements, event management, as well as identify, facilitate sponsorship agreements, assist with building relationships and business contracts within the sporting arena, implement marketing strategies and budgets and manage community relations through my established reputation and elite corporate network in the Sporting industry, I ensured the successful contract negotiations for my clients and partnered with media channels such as Channel 9, Triple M Radio, Channel 7 and Channel 9 Footy Show.Furthermore, as a successful AFL accredited player agent I managed high profile AFL players such as Gary Ablett Snr, Gary Ablett Jnr, Nathan Ablett, Warwick Capper and Shane Tuck. During this time, I assessed athletes positioning, implemented strategic career marketing plans, assisted in building a recognised name and brand for my clients, whilst maximising revenue streams. I jointly successfully established the EJ Whitten Legends Game, assisted in the development of the Les Twentyman Foundation, created the Les Twentman Foundation Gala Dinner, as well as produced and managed concerts and public events for Jimmy Barnes, Wiggles and Edwin Moses. Key career achievements include orchestrating one of the highest rating events on Australian TV as well as the 2nd highest rating AFL game for the year 2015.
